The National Weather Service in Peachtree City has issued a

* Tornado Warning for...
Northeastern Macon County in west central Georgia...
Southern Peach County in central Georgia...
Central Houston County in central Georgia...

* Until 730 AM EDT.

* At 640 AM EDT, a severe thunderstorm capable of producing a tornado
was located over Marshallville, or near Fort Valley, moving east at
30 mph.

HAZARD...Tornado.

SOURCE...Radar indicated rotation.

IMPACT...Flying debris will be dangerous to those caught without
shelter. Mobile homes will be damaged or destroyed.
Damage to roofs, windows, and vehicles will occur. Tree
damage is likely.

* Locations impacted include...
Perry, Fort Valley, Warner Robins, Marshallville, Robins AFB, Saint
Louis, Meadowdale, Robins Air Force Base, Sand Bed, Houston Lake,
Lakewood, Moss Oak, Winchester, Bonaire, Miami Valley, Kathleen,
and Clinchfield.
TAKE COVER NOW! Move to a basement or an interior room on the lowest
floor of a sturdy building. Avoid windows. If you are outdoors, in a
mobile home, or in a vehicle, move to the closest substantial shelter
and protect yourself from flying debris.

City of Warner Robins Launches Community Food Drive and Resource Hub

The City of Warner Robins has announced the launch of a Community Food Drive to assist residents impacted by the federal government shutdown and the loss of SNAP benefits. For up-to-date information, donation details, and a full list of available resources, residents are encouraged to visit the Community Support Hub at www.wrga.gov/page/community-support-hub

As part of the City’s broader effort to connect those who need support with those ready to help, the food drive serves as one of the first steps in a larger initiative to coordinate community-wide relief. The City is working closely with local partners and organizations to ensure resources are accessible to residents who may be facing unexpected challenges during this time.

Residents, businesses, churches, and organizations are encouraged to fill out the Community Support Partner Form on the city website: wrga.gov/forms/community-support-partner-form


HOW YOU CAN HELP

• Start gathering non-perishable food items
• Encourage your business, church, or organization to participate
• Share information across your networks and social media to help reach those in need

ITEMS NEEDED

• All non-perishable food items (especially peanut butter)
• Paper and cleaning products
• Personal hygiene and baby care items

DONATION LOCATIONS
Monday-Friday, 8:00AM - 7:00PM
• Fire Station #1: 111 N Pleasant Hill Rd, Warner Robins
• Fire Station #3: 117 Chestnut Rd, Warner Robins
• Fire Station #4: 737 N Houston Rd, Warner Robins
• Fire Station #5: 705 Sandy Run Rd, Warner Robins
• Fire Station #6: 701 Osigian Blvd, Warner Robins
• Fire Station #7: 955 Lake Joy Rd, Warner Robins
• Fire Station #8: 91 Victory Way, Bonaire
